Chablis, Burgundy, France
Domaine François Raveneau
Raveneau is widely considered the best producer in Chablis, a small northern French region that makes bone-dry white wines from Chardonnay. This is from one of their single vineyards — bottles rarely appear for sale and cost multiples of what most Chablis fetches.
